The nurse is trying to improve the nutritional status of residents in the nursing home. Which recommendations should the nurse implement?
Develop a seating chart for the main dining room based on the unit to facilitate a more organized and efficient meal delivery
Provide nutritious food according to the residents' expressed food preferences.
Replace the fluorescent lighting with candles at every table to create a cozy, restaurant-like atmosphere.
Distribute "med-pass nutritional supplements.
Correct Answer : B,D
B. Provide nutritious food according to the residents' expressed food preferences.
Explanation: Offering nutritious food based on residents' preferences can enhance their satisfaction with meals, making them more likely to eat and maintain adequate nutritional intake. Taking individual preferences into account helps create a more person-centered approach to nutrition.
D. Distribute "med-pass" nutritional supplements.
Explanation: Nutritional supplements may be beneficial for residents who have difficulty meeting their nutritional needs through regular meals. "Med-pass" supplements can be distributed with medications or as a separate supplement to enhance calorie and nutrient intake, especially for those with specific dietary requirements.
The other options are not recommended:
A. Develop a seating chart for the main dining room based on the unit to facilitate a more organized and efficient meal delivery.
Explanation: While organization and efficiency are important, creating a seating chart based on the unit might not directly address the nutritional status of residents. Instead, focus should be on providing appetizing, nutritious meals and accommodating residents' preferences.
C. Replace the fluorescent lighting with candles at every table to create a cozy, restaurant-like atmosphere.
Explanation: While creating a pleasant dining environment is important, replacing fluorescent lighting with candles may not be practical or safe in a healthcare setting. Moreover, the emphasis should be on the nutritional content of the meals rather than the ambiance.
